From 5bc1ab428b18ed1f368521db90d7733ab81f1d2b Mon Sep 17 00:00:00 2001 From: WeebDataHoarder Date: Sat, 3 May 2025 04:17:02 +0200 Subject: [PATCH] docker: add GOAWAY_CHALLENGE_TEMPLATE_LOGO parameter to Dockerfile --- Dockerfile | 1 + docker-entrypoint.sh | 4 +++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index 9a753d1..da3b1ef 100644 --- a/Dockerfile +++ b/Dockerfile @@ -48,6 +48,7 @@ ENV GOAWAY_POLICY="/policy.yml" ENV GOAWAY_POLICY_SNIPPETS="" ENV GOAWAY_CHALLENGE_TEMPLATE="anubis" ENV GOAWAY_CHALLENGE_TEMPLATE_THEME="" +ENV GOAWAY_CHALLENGE_TEMPLATE_LOGO="" ENV GOAWAY_SLOG_LEVEL="WARN" ENV GOAWAY_CLIENT_IP_HEADER="" ENV GOAWAY_BACKEND_IP_HEADER="" diff --git a/docker-entrypoint.sh b/docker-entrypoint.sh index 38d9005..136d39e 100755 --- a/docker-entrypoint.sh +++ b/docker-entrypoint.sh @@ -9,7 +9,9 @@ if [ $# -eq 0 ] || [ "${1#-}" != "$1" ]; then --policy "${GOAWAY_POLICY}" --policy-snippets "/snippets" --policy-snippets "${GOAWAY_POLICY_SNIPPETS}" \ --client-ip-header "${GOAWAY_CLIENT_IP_HEADER}" --backend-ip-header "${GOAWAY_BACKEND_IP_HEADER}" \ --cache "${GOAWAY_CACHE}" \ - --challenge-template "${GOAWAY_CHALLENGE_TEMPLATE}" --challenge-template-theme "${GOAWAY_CHALLENGE_TEMPLATE_THEME}" \ + --challenge-template "${GOAWAY_CHALLENGE_TEMPLATE}" \ + --challenge-template-logo "${GOAWAY_CHALLENGE_TEMPLATE_LOGO}" \ + --challenge-template-theme "${GOAWAY_CHALLENGE_TEMPLATE_THEME}" \ --slog-level "${GOAWAY_SLOG_LEVEL}" \ --acme-autocert "${GOAWAY_ACME_AUTOCERT}" \ --backend "${GOAWAY_BACKEND}" \